Research On Education Location Choice Of Urban Migrant Family

This paper focused on the strategy of migrant families in urban area in how to choose the housing location based on the consideration of education quality.Education resource is distributed by the choices of community where families live with children.In this way parents are able to choose where to l ive to meet their education demand.At the same time,there are many other targets in this process families have to meet,including public services like healthcare and police,location characters like bus stations and housing amenties.Eventually,every fa mily have to balance their weights on each attribute on account of different background such as education level,races,income and family structure.And this process results in heterogeneity in the choice of community location out of the pursuit of higher labor market accomplishment and education target.In this sense,the research focused on the particular group of migrant families and their housing choice.Furthermore the mechanism behind the process were tested in detail.The field research focused on Nangang district in Harbin which is the largest central district in the city.Initially questionnaires were designed in full factorial orthogonal approach and latter classified into blocks for interviewees who are assumed to be rational ideally to make the right choice.After collecting data,conditional logit model was applied to analyses and eventually results are: migrant families place higher weights on education when choosing housing location and commuting accessibility,housing amenities and families in the same like also work.When the samples were classified by income quintiles,differences in preference appears positively as the income changes higher.The paper further found that family structure,income,migrant background and expected return were st rongly associated with diversified weight placed on the education following by analytics on mechanism of the heterogeneity.
Keywords/Search Tags:migrant family, basic education, urban location, conditional logit
